Hi all, will be on the liberty 8/9 and my 75 yo mom asked me how much tip do you give for room service. Having never used it I wasn't sure what the answer was. Can someone let me know please. And whilst on the topic of food, I love fettuccini Alfredo -- is that available on the liberty? Thanks and so excited!

We do $1-$2.00 depending on what we order, and how many people. We have a social hour a few nights, and order the cheese and fruit trays, along with a few sandwiches that someone may order, so for that we tip $10.00 because its often delivered by two people. The room service staff has taken care of us when cruising whether on Carnival or Royal, so wed return the favor with tips, and the comment cards.

i always bring an envelope from home with me, with about 50 one dollar bills in it...$2-$3 tip for each order...if i have leftover dollars at the end, i give it to the room steward along with any additional tip for him that i feel he deserves..

I usually tip 2.00.

 

re; fettucine alfredo...it is not available by room service for certain. Room service only had a breakfast menu (no eggs, bacon, sausage) just a continental breakfast, and the rest of the menu is sandwiches, salads and desserts. No fettucine alfredo from room servce sorry. I also dont recall seeing it on any dining room menu, though there are many pasta dishes available.
